According to existing research, we know that mental illnesses are the result of gene-environment interactions. People inherit genetic vulnerabilities to mental illnesses, which are then influenced (or even triggered) by the environment. This idea is called the ____________________ ____________ ___________
Diathesis Stress Model

List the axis and what goes on them
Axis I - most psychiatric diagnoses Axis II - personality disorder and MR Axis III - health conditions Axis IV - psychosocial issues Axis V - GAF

According to Robert Sapolsky's findings, explain the relationship between rank, stress, and health
Lower rank --> Higher Stress Hormones --> Worse Health High rank --> Lower Stress Hormones --> Better Health
